Fuel pump replacement
Question??? My fuel pump sprung a leak around one of the electrical terminals so need to replace it and the filter.. My question is? Which of the 2 soft lines to a valve next to the pump is the one from the gas tank? I clamped the big one shut with a pair of vice grips but a lot of fuel still drains out. Do I need to clamp both of them and what is the other line? A return line?? Also I didnt get new copper crush washers, Should I replace these at the same time. Thanks in advance.

I replaced mine several months ago and from what I remember, I clamped both lines. As for the crushed washers, you most definately should replace them. If you don't, you run a good chance of having a leak. No sense in going under the car twice. It is a fairly easy repair, as long as the nuts and bolts aren't rusted. I sprayed WD40 on them the night before I did the work and everything came off with no problems. Good luck.
